Piano rolls and music creativity: conflict or opportunity?
Zappala' Pietro
2025-01-01
Abstract
The essay considers different types of piano rolls in view of the level of expressiveness they can express, despite being designed for mechanical reproduction. Likewise, the level of creativity they leave to the performer is assessed.
